About H. Glasbrenner
H. Glasbrenner is a scholar working on Ceramics and Composites, Filtration and Separation, Materials Chemistry, Radiation and Aerospace Engineering, having authored 42 papers that have together received 1.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nuclear Materials and Properties (26 papers), Fusion materials and technologies (23 papers), Nuclear reactor physics and engineering (8 papers), Intermetallics and Advanced Alloy Properties (7 papers), High-Temperature Coating Behaviors (6 papers), Ion-surface interactions and analysis (5 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(5 papers) and Advanced ceramic materials synthesis (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Filtration and Separation (39 citations), Metals and Alloys (46 citations), Aerospace Engineering (424 citations), Materials Chemistry (743 citations) and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es (85 citations). H. Glasbrenner has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Switzerland and France. Frequent co-authors include J. Konys, F. Gröschel, Z. Voß, A. Perujo, Olaf Wedemeyer, H.U. Borgstedt, Yong Dai, E. Serra, Hermann Weingaertner and G. Benamati.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Nuclear Materials, Fusion Engineering and Design, The Journal of Physical Chemistry, Nuclear Engineering and Design and Microchimica Acta.
